The Ultimate Buying Guide for Fitbit Sense Bands

Overview

Fitbit Sense is a popular smartwatch that comes with a range of features, including heart rate monitoring, GPS tracking, NFC payments, and sleep tracking. However, one of the best things about the Fitbit Sense is the ability to customize it with different bands. In this buying guide, we'll explore the different types of Fitbit Sense bands available, key considerations when choosing a band, features to look for, prices, and tips to help you make the best choice.

Types

- Silicone bands: These are the most common type of Fitbit Sense bands. They are comfortable, durable, and come in a range of colors.

- Leather bands: Leather bands are a great choice if you want a more formal look. They are comfortable and stylish, but may not be as durable as silicone bands.

- Metal bands: Metal bands are a premium option that add a touch of elegance to your Fitbit Sense. They are durable and come in a range of colors and styles.

- Nylon bands: Nylon bands are a great choice if you want a more casual look. They are comfortable, durable, and come in a range of colors.

Prices

Fitbit Sense bands range in price from around $10 for basic silicone bands to $100 or more for premium metal bands.

FAQs

Q: Can I use any band with my Fitbit Sense?

A: No, you need to make sure you choose a band that is compatible with the Fitbit Sense.

Q: How do I know what size band to buy?

A: Fitbit provides a sizing guide on their website to help you choose the right size band.

Q: Are all Fitbit Sense bands water-resistant?

A: No, not all bands are water-resistant. Make sure you check the specifications before making a purchase.

Q: Can I wear my Fitbit Sense band while sleeping?

A: Yes, most Fitbit Sense bands are designed to be worn 24/7, including while sleeping.

Q: How do I clean my Fitbit Sense band?

A: You can clean your band with a damp cloth or a mild soap and water solution.
